/ˈpɹɒd.əkt/ · noun
Anything that is produced; a result..
The product of last month's quality standards committee is quite good, even though the process was flawed.
To whom thus Michael: These are the product / Of those ill-mated marriages thou sawest;
These institutions are the products of enthusiasm; they are the instruments of wisdom.
The truth is that [Isaac] Newton was very much a product of his time. The colossus of science was not the first king of reason, Keynes wrote after reading Newton’s unpublished manuscripts. Instead “he was the last of the magicians”.
That store offers a variety of products. We've got to sell a lot of product by the end of the month.
Wash excess product out of your hair.
He puts his fingers in Miller’s hair, which is greasy with product.
